State Govt Hiding Things: NCPCR Chief Says Bengal 'Rape And Murder' Could Be 'Trafficking Case'

NCPCR chief slams Mamata Banerjee-led Bengal government, alleges the state government is hiding things in the case related to the alleged rape and murder of a Dalit girl.

Bengal Rape And Murder: National Commission for Protection of Child Rights (NCPCR) chief Priyank Kanoongo on Monday alleged that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ee-led TMC government is hiding things in the case pertaining to the death of a minor Dalit girl in the state. He said that proper investigation was not done into the matter and it could be a 'trafficking case'. Speaking to news agency ANI, he said that he met the doctors and claimed that there's a difference between the inputs given by doctors and those put forward by the police and family.

"Today we met the doctors. There is a difference between doctors' input, police input, and family input. There was no proper investigation done in the case. We will mention all these points in our report and submit it to the govt of India. The state govt is trying to hide things. This could be a trafficking case," he said, as quoted by ANI.

Kanoongo on Sunday said that they have met with the family members of the minor girl who was allegedly raped and murdered by a group of men in North Dinajpur earlier this week, news agency ANI reported.

Fresh violence erupted in Kaliaganj as locals staged protests against the incident on Saturday. Police had to resort to gas shells and charge batons to bring the situation under control, PTI reported. 

Several shops and e-rickshaws were set on fire by the agitating mob, that demanded the arrest of those behind the incident. Roads were also blocked and stones were hurled at the police, as per the report. 

The preliminary post-mortem report of the minor girl who was killed in West Bengal's North Dinajpur district earlier last week has revealed that death occurred due to some poisonous substance and there was no injury marks found on the body, news agency PTI quoted the Superintendent of Police (SP) Md Sana Akhtar as saying. Police further said that a 20-year-old man, identified as the prime accused in the case, was arrested.
